Frequently Asked Questions About Sober Living and Halfway Houses in Appleton

What are halfway houses and sober living homes in Appleton?

Halfway houses, also known as sober living homes, are transitional residences in Appleton designed to support individuals in early recovery from substance abuse or addiction. These homes can provide a structured and sober environment where residents can continue building life skills and maintaining their sobriety while transitioning back into independent living.

How do halfway houses work in Appleton?

Halfway houses in Appleton typically operate as supportive environments for individuals in recovery. Residents are often required to follow house rules, attend support meetings, participate in therapy or counseling sessions, and maintain sobriety. These homes typically offer a sense of community, accountability, and a safe space for individuals to practice healthy behaviors before fully returning to independent living.

How can I find a halfway house or sober living home in Appleton?

To find a halfway house or sober living home in Appleton, you can search online directories, contact local addiction treatment centers, reach out to support groups, or consult with addiction specialists. It's important to research and choose a reputable halfway house that aligns with your recovery goals and needs.

What services are offered at sober living homes in Appleton?

Sober living homes in Appleton may offer a range of services including structured living arrangements, peer support, access to counseling or therapy, drug testing, life skills training, and guidance on creating a relapse prevention plan. The goal is to provide residents with a supportive environment as they work toward sustained sobriety and personal growth.

Are halfway houses in Appleton only for individuals recently out of rehab?

Halfway houses in Appleton may not be solely for individuals recently out of rehab. While they often cater to those in early recovery, halfway houses can be beneficial for anyone seeking a supportive and structured environment to maintain their sobriety. Some residents may have completed formal treatment, while others may be transitioning from other living situations.

How long can I stay at a sober living home in Appleton?

The length of stay at a sober living home in Appleton can vary. Some programs may have a set duration, often around three to six months, while others may be more flexible depending on individual progress. The goal is to provide residents with enough time to develop essential life skills and solidify their recovery foundation before transitioning to independent living.

Are halfway houses in Appleton gender-specific?

Some halfway houses in Appleton may offer gender-specific residences. This arrangement helps create a safe and supportive environment where residents can relate to and support one another. Gender-specific halfway houses also address specific needs and concerns that may arise during recovery, contributing to a more focused and effective recovery experience.

How much does it cost to stay at a halfway house or sober living home in Appleton?

The cost of staying at a halfway house or sober living home in Appleton varies depending on factors such as location, amenities, and the level of support provided. Some homes may offer sliding scale fees based on income, while others may have fixed rates. It's important to inquire about costs and any potential additional expenses before committing to a specific halfway house.

Can I work or attend school while living in a halfway house in Appleton?

Some halfway houses in Appleton may encourage residents to work or attend school as part of their recovery journey. Some programs may have specific guidelines or requirements regarding employment or education. Engaging in productive activities can help individuals build a sense of purpose and responsibility as they transition back into a more independent lifestyle.

How can I ensure the quality and safety of a sober living home in Appleton?

To ensure the quality and safety of a sober living home in Appleton, it's recommended to research thoroughly. Look for homes that are licensed, accredited, or affiliated with reputable organizations. Read reviews and testimonials from former residents, visit the facility if possible, and ask questions about their program, staff qualifications, and house rules. Connecting with local addiction professionals can also provide valuable insights.
